No.  It is the nature of the beast. (The good news is that the product you
got was a true epoxy.)

Epoxy resins (and paints made from them, which are based on epoxy resins)
have super adhesion characteristics, but are sensitive to oxidation and
ultraviolet light.  This exposure causes them to oxidize, and get a dull,
whitish surface.  This can be polished off, but it will reappear.

Polyurethanes are famous for their high gloss (and gloss retention).

Epoxies are frequently used for primers and polyurethanes for top coats.
